An equation is written to represent the relationship between the temperature in Alaska during a snow storm, y, as it relates to

the time in hours, x, since the storm started. A graph of the equation is created. Which quadrants of a coordinate grid should be used to display this data

<u>Answer:</u>

The first and fourth quadrants


<u>Explanation:</u>

We are given that the time in hours is given on the x-axis and that the temperature is represented on the y-axis


Since we know that the time cannot be negative, therefore, the x-coordinate cannot be negative.

This means that for the x-axis, we can use the first and fourth quadrants


Since the temperature can be negative, therefore, the y-coordinate can either be positive or negative.

This means that for the y-axis, we can use the four quadrants


Combining the above two conditions, we can deduce that we can use only the first and fourth quadrants to represent the required data
